Crafted from a jacquard base with striking warp print sleeves, this bomber jacket exudes contemporary flair. The raglan sleeves add a touch of sporty elegance, blending seamlessly with the jacket's modern design. Made from sustainable materials sourced from archived fabrics, this piece is a testament to our commitment to eco-conscious fashion.

Key Features:

  • Jacquard base with warp print sleeves for a distinctive look
  • Raglan sleeves for added comfort and style
  • Sustainable materials sourced from archived fabrics

Washing Instructions:

  • Machine wash cold with similar colors
  • Hang to dry or tumble dry on low heat
